> > May be there is a log file I can read?
>
> Check /var/log/XFree86.0.log, also your ~/xsession-errors.
>
> I had/have a similar problem, and I'm convinced it is caused by X's
> graphics driver for my ATI card, and the crashes were caused by GL
> rendering.
>
> I manage to get a stable system by not using GL screensavers and
staying
> away from GL graphics software and games. I *really* hope X 4.2 can
> address this issue...
Same exact issues here - I can usualy ssh in and cleanly kill off the
X
processes, though. I'm left with nothing in my logs for clues, but I
came to this conclusion after trying to make it freeze for some time
with diferent apps, and deciding that it was GL related.
